The 90-Day Routine of Successful Web Developers
Becoming the best web developer is not just limited to having technical skills. It also requires continuously improving yourself by adopting daily routine and discipline. In this article, we will explore the 90-day daily routine followed by top web developers. These habits cover various areas such as coding, continuous learning, project management, communication, and personal development. By incorporating these habits into your daily routine, you can become a more successful and effective web developer.
Here Are The Daily 90 Routine Of The Best Web Developers:
Learning and Improvement:
Dedicate time every day to learn something new.
Start the day with a clear plan.
Organize tasks based on priority and practice time management.
Develop your skills by creating personal projects.
Practice coding regularly to improve your coding skills.
Be a good problem solver in addition to being a skilled programmer.
Conduct efficient research to find resources effectively.
Build your own code library.
Review and improve your code regularly.
Organize and clean your workspace regularly.
Collaboration and Communication:
Work collaboratively in team projects.
Adhere to coding standards and maintain consistency.
Seek feedback regularly during the development process.
Read and try to understand other people's code.
Be an effective communicator and express yourself clearly.
Prevent unnecessary code complexity and embrace simplicity.
Document your code and explain its functionality.
Initiate and manage your own projects.
Experiment with innovative ideas and be open to new approaches.
Stay updated on new technologies and trends.
Test and debug your projects to ensure their functionality.
Stay passionate about your work and work with dedication.
Embrace feedback positively and continuously improve yourself.
Identify your weaknesses and work on improving them.
Maintain work-life balance by engaging in non-work activities.
Take breaks to rest your mind and recharge.
Technical Skills and Knowledge:
Don't be afraid to make mistakes and embrace trial and error.
Plan ahead to manage future projects effectively.
Analyze problems and generate effective solutions.
Utilize current tools and development environments.
Contribute to open-source projects and engage with the community.
Improve project management skills and optimize workflow processes.
Seek mentorship and learn from experienced developers.
Generate innovative solutions using creative thinking techniques.
Love your work and keep your motivation high.
Follow software engineering principles and best practices.
Read technical articles and resources daily.
Enroll in online courses for continuous self-improvement.
Follow web development communities on social media.
Take regular breaks while coding to rest your eyes.
Use your communication skills in team collaborations.
Establish coding standards and ensure consistency within the team.
Optimize your workflow and processes.
Actively listen to understand project requirements.
Debug efficiently and solve problems quickly.
Test your code continuously and ensure quality.
Contribute to open-source projects and engage with the community.
Value teamwork and collaborate with other developers.
Conduct regular code reviews and evaluate feedback.
Initiate your own projects and constantly generate innovative ideas.
Personal Development and Growth:
Enhance problem-solving skills to provide quick and effective solutions.
Acquire knowledge of data structures and algorithms.
Continuously research new technologies and tools.
Manage workplace stress using relaxation and stress-reduction techniques.
Stay updated and prioritize personal development.
Plan and track your work systematically.
Establish a self-learning structure for effective learning.
Join technology communities and attend events.
Interact with customers and users, striving to understand their needs.
Set daily small goals for yourself and achieve them.
Stay current and adapt to new technologies and trends.
Communicate regularly with team members for collaboration and knowledge sharing.
Practice daily algorithm exercises to improve coding practices.
Read inspiring web development projects and success stories for motivation.
Allocate time to attend conferences, seminars, and workshops related.
Allocate time to attend conferences, seminars, and trainings related to your work.
Use automation tools and workflow systems to optimize the software development process.
Be conscious of security and take measures to make your web applications secure.
Use time management and prioritization techniques to effectively manage your workload.
Develop and showcase your portfolio by working on personal projects and presenting them.
Research new technologies and tools and seize opportunities to try them out.
Make use of relevant resources to improve project management and team organization skills.
Share your thoughts and experiences by creating your own website or blog.
Acquire knowledge about structured data storage systems and databases.
Enhance software quality and reduce error rates by using test automation tools.
Continuously evaluate yourself and identify areas for improvement.
Seek feedback from clients and business partners and remain open to improvements.
Make use of opportunities such as presentations or writing to improve your communication skills.
Use operating systems and productivity tools to increase work efficiency.
Develop analytical thinking and problem-solving skills to tackle complex problems.
Stay updated on trends related to your work and focus on in-demand technologies.
Be active in web development communities and engage in knowledge sharing with other developers.
Familiarize yourself with project management methodologies to define and manage project processes.
Optimize websites for performance and fast loading times.
Document your code and adhere to clean code principles to ensure software maintainability.
Evaluate your projects and work processes regularly through retrospectives.
Explore and draw inspiration from other disciplines to discover new ideas.
Improve yourself by participating in technical interviews and code reviews.
Share your experiences and mentor new developers to help them grow.
Be conscious of hearing-impaired users and accessibility issues, designing websites accordingly.
Bonus : Stay committed to your work with passion and strive for continuous self-improvement.
Summary :
These 90 daily routine are important factors that support the success and continuous improvement of top web developers. By adopting these habits, you can progress further in the field of web development and become a professional developer.
Subscribe to my newsletter
Read articles from Alp Beyazgül directly inside your inbox. Subscribe to the newsletter, and don't miss out.
Written by
Alp Beyazgül
Alp Beyazgül
Sn. Web Developer - SEO Specialist - CyberSecurity Researcher - Blogger | Founder of Beyazgül Group